2. The ideal time to visit Cao Bang

According to travel experience in Cao Bang, the weather here is divided into two main seasons, each with its own unique beauty. You can choose the most suitable time based on your preferences and the purpose of your trip:

  • Spring (March - May): Cao Bang is adorned with the vibrant colors of plum and peach blossoms and lush green scenery. The pleasant weather is ideal for visiting outdoor tourist attractions.
  • Summer (June - August): This is when Ban Gioc Waterfall – the symbol of Cao Bang tourism – is at its most majestic with abundant water. Activities such as swimming in the stream, hiking, and camping are also very popular during this season.
  • Autumn (September - November): Buckwheat flowers bloom profusely, creating a romantic scene that attracts many tourists to Cao Bang to take photos and enjoy the scenery.
  • Winter (December - February): Winter brings a mystical beauty with mist-shrouded mountains and forests. This is also the time when Cao Bang organizes many unique traditional festivals.

 

3. Transportation options to Cao Bang

Cao Bang is one of the famous tourist destinations in Northeast Vietnam, so you can easily get there. Based on Cao Bang travel experience, you can refer to the following information when traveling in Cao Bang:

3.1. How to get to Cao Bang

Currently, there are no direct flights to Cao Bang, but you can choose one of the following transportation options:

  • By bus: Departing from Hanoi , you can catch a bus at My Dinh or Gia Lam bus station. Ticket prices range from 150,000 to 300,000 VND per trip, with a travel time of approximately 6-7 hours.
  • Motorbikes: For those who love adventure travel, motorbikes are the ideal choice for conquering the enchanting mountain and forest routes of Northeast Vietnam.
  • Private car: This is a convenient option if you're traveling with family or a group of friends, offering flexibility in your schedule.
  • If you are coming from the South or Central region, fly to Noi Bai Airport (Hanoi), then continue your journey to Cao Bang by bus or car.

 

3.2. Transportation in Cao Bang

Once you arrive in Cao Bang, you can choose from the following transportation options to get between attractions:

  • Renting a motorbike: Motorbikes are the most popular option, giving you the flexibility to explore locations deep in the mountains and forests.
  • Taxis: Easily found in the center of Cao Bang city, suitable for groups of friends or families.
  • Motorbike taxis: Suitable for short trips or to attractions near the city center.
  • Buses or intercity coaches: Suitable if you want to travel between districts on a budget.

4.1. Ban Gioc Waterfall

Ban Gioc Waterfall - Vietnam's "Number One Waterfall" (Image source: Collected)

Address: Quây Sơn River, Đàm Thủy Commune, Trùng Khánh District, Cao Bằng Province
Dubbed the symbol of Cao Bang tourism, Ban Gioc Waterfall is not only one of the most beautiful waterfalls in Vietnam but also ranks among the top 21 most beautiful waterfalls in the world, according to a prestigious magazine. It is the largest waterfall in Southeast Asia and also the fourth largest border waterfall in the world. With its magnificent natural scenery and the resounding roar of the waterfall, Ban Gioc Waterfall is an unmissable destination in any Cao Bang tour.

4.2. Pac Bo Historical Site

Tracing the roots of history at the Pac Bo historical site (Image source: Collected)

Address: Truong Ha Commune, Ha Quang District, Cao Bang Province
This place is closely associated with the revolutionary life of President Ho Chi Minh during his early days back in the homeland. When you visit, you can see Pac Bo Cave, where President Ho Chi Minh lived and worked, and the clear, blue Lenin Stream. The picturesque scenery combined with its profound historical value makes Pac Bo a memorable destination on your journey to explore Cao Bang.

4.3. Nguom Ngao Cave

Address: Dam Thuy Commune, Trung Khanh District
Located just 5km from Ban Gioc Waterfall, Nguom Ngao Cave is a natural masterpiece formed by limestone, stretching over 2,100m in length, and is a famous tourist destination in Cao Bang. The cave possesses a unique and mysterious beauty, along with a cool atmosphere year-round, providing a pleasant feeling for visitors.

4.4. Mount Phja Piót (Eye of the God)

"The Eye of the Mountain God" in Cao Bang (Image source: Collected)

Address: Thang Hen Lake Complex
Mount Eye of God, also known as Thung Mountain, is an attractive tourist destination in Cao Bang for those who love exploring nature. It stands out with its vast valley, lush green meadows, and peaceful, unspoiled atmosphere. It's also an ideal place to enjoy moments of relaxation.

4.5. Khuoi Ky Ancient Stone Village

Address: Dam Thuy Commune, Trung Khanh District, Cao Bang Province
Khuoi Ky Ancient Stone Village is a unique village with over 400 years of history, where the stone houses of the Tay ethnic group are still preserved intact. It's a destination that not only offers a unique cultural experience but also provides an interesting perspective on the traditional architecture of the local people.

4.6. Lung Pan Bamboo Forest

Address: Lung Pan Commune, Bao Lac District, Cao Bang Province
The Lung Pan bamboo forest is likened to a beautiful natural painting with its towering, straight rows of bamboo. Visitors can immerse themselves in the peaceful atmosphere, enjoy the fresh air, and participate in activities such as taking photos, strolling, or relaxing amidst nature.

5.3. Famous dishes to try when traveling to Cao Bang

Cao Bang sour pho (Image source: Collected)

Cao Bang not only captivates tourists with its majestic natural landscapes but also with its flavorful highland cuisine. Exploring Cao Bang's culinary scene, you'll experience the uniqueness of each specialty dish, prepared from local ingredients and reflecting the rich culture of the people here.

  • Cao Bang Sour Pho: Sour pho is a prominent specialty dish, characteristic of the Northeast mountainous region. The dish features a harmonious combination of soft rice noodles, char siu pork, pork liver, thinly sliced ​​cucumber, fragrant roasted peanuts, and a sweet and sour fish sauce made according to a unique recipe. The special thing about sour pho is its refreshing sourness and mild spiciness, stimulating the taste buds, making it perfect for enjoying on hot summer days.
  • Eight-Colored Dried Rice Noodles: Dubbed a "one-of-a-kind" dish of Cao Bang province, eight-colored dried rice noodles impress with their noodles made from natural ingredients such as brown rice, perilla leaves, butterfly pea flowers, corn, purple sweet potatoes, and moringa. Each color is not only visually appealing but also has its own distinct flavor, offering a rich experience for diners. This dish is usually eaten with chicken, herbs, and a special dipping sauce.
  • Cao Bang rice rolls: Unlike rice rolls in the lowlands, Cao Bang rice rolls have a thin, soft, and smooth wrapper made from finely ground rice flour. The unique feature lies in the dipping sauce, usually made from pork bones, giving it a rich and unforgettable flavor. The rolls are often served with stir-fried minced meat, wood ear mushrooms, and fried onions. This is a popular breakfast dish for locals and tourists alike.
  • Pan-fried dumplings: Pan-fried dumplings are a familiar street food, especially popular in winter. Made from a mixture of glutinous rice flour and regular rice flour, they are filled with minced pork mixed with wood ear mushrooms, shiitake mushrooms, and scallions, then deep-fried until golden brown. The dumplings are crispy on the outside and soft and fragrant on the inside, served with fresh vegetables and sweet and sour fish sauce, creating a very appealing flavor.
  • Sour pork: Cao Bang sour pork is a traditional dish of the Tay and Nung people, meticulously prepared. After initial processing, the pork is marinated with salt, roasted rice powder, and characteristic spices, then wrapped in banana leaves and naturally fermented for several days. Sour pork has a refreshing sour taste and a mild spiciness, and is often served with herbs, rice crackers, and roasted peanuts, creating a unique and unforgettable flavor.
  • Cao Bang Khao Cake: Khao cake is an indispensable traditional dish during Tet (Lunar New Year) for the Tay and Nung people. The cake is made from fragrant roasted glutinous rice, ground into a fine powder, with a filling of brown sugar, pork fat, and peanuts. When eaten, the cake has a mild sweetness, a rich, creamy flavor, and a characteristic chewy texture. It is also a popular souvenir for many tourists.
  • Coóng Phù cake: Also known as glutinous rice dumplings, Coóng Phù cakes are commonly found at festivals and Tet (Lunar New Year) celebrations in Cao Bằng. Made from smooth, sticky glutinous rice flour, filled with mung bean or brown sugar, the cake is boiled until cooked and then topped with roasted peanuts and finely chopped ginger. Its sweet, fragrant flavor symbolizes fulfillment and prosperity.
